Lucy Ryan Obituary

Ryan, Lucy A. (nee O'Sullivan) Devoted wife of John (Ret. CPD) for 46 years; loving mother of Catherine (Donald) Torpy, Noreen (Tony) Signorelli, Thomas (Diane), Sean (Annemarie), Sheila, Tracey (John) Moran, Martin (Jamie Reddington) and Daniel (Sara); proud grandma of Patrick, Sean, Christopher, Meghan, Clare, Helen, Sophie, Frank, Agnes, Gemma, Marty, Kate, Jack, Matthew, Michael, Grace, Abby, Emily, Ryan, Emma, Kelly, Jack, Rosie, and Margo; dear sister of Thomas (late Mary), Gerald (Sheila) and Catherine (Ulick) O'Sullivan; beloved daughter of the late Catherine and Thomas O'Sullivan, and daughter-in-law of the late Katherine Popovits; fond aunt to many nieces and nephews; will be dearly missed by countless friends. Visitation Thursday 3:00 p.m. to 9:00 p.m. Funeral Friday, 9:30 a.m. from Curley Funeral Home, 6116 W. 111th Street, Chicago Ridge to Most Holy Redeemer Church, 9525 S. Lawndale, Evergreen Park. Mass 10:30 a.m. Interment Private. For funeral info www.curleyfuneralhome.com or 708-422-2700.

Published by Chicago Sun-Times on Apr. 2, 2014.
